Hacker & Moore's Essentials of Obstetrics and Gynecology, by Drs. Neville F. Hacker, Joseph C. Gambone, and Calvin J. Hobel, is the #1 choice of ob/gyn residents and medical students because of its concise focus, comprehensive coverage, and easy-to-use format. This new edition features updated clinical cases and assessments, new Clinical Key boxes, and thoroughly revised text and images that reflect today’s best knowledge on the evaluation, diagnosis, and management of a wide range of ob/gyn disorders.

PART 1 Introduction
1. A Life-Course Perspective for Women’s Health Care
2. Clinical Approach to the Patient
3. Female Reproductive Anatomy and Embryology
4. Female Reproductive Physiology
PART 2 Obstetrics
5. Endocrinology of Pregnancy and Parturition
6. Maternal Physiologic and Immunologic Adaptation to Pregnancy
7. Antepartum Care
8. Normal Labor, Delivery, and Postpartum Care
9. Fetal Surveillance during Labor
10. Obstetric Hemorrhage
11. Uterine Contractility and Dystocia
12. Obstetric Complications
13. Multifetal Gestation and Malpresentation
14. Hypertensive Disorders of Pregnancy
15. Rhesus Alloimmunization
16. Common Medical and Surgical Conditions Complicating Pregnancy
17. Obstetric Procedures
PART 3 Gynecology
18. Benign Conditions and Congenital Anomalies of the Vulva and Vagina
19. Benign Conditions and Congenital Anomalies of the Uterine Corpus and Cervix
20. Benign Conditions and Congenital Anomalies of the Ovaries and Fallopian Tubes
21. Pelvic Pain
22. Infectious Diseases of the Female Reproductive and Urinary Tract
23. Pelvic Floor Disorders
24. Ectopic Pregnancy
25. Endometriosis and Adenomyosis
26. Abnormal Uterine Bleeding
27. Family Planning
28. Sexuality and Female Sexual Dysfunction
29. Intimate Partner and Family Violence, Sexual Assault, and Rape
30. Breast Disease
31. Gynecologic Procedures
PART 4 Reproductive Endocrinology and Infertility
32. Puberty and Disorders of Pubertal Development
33. Amenorrhea, Oligomenorrhea, and Hyperandrogenic Disorders
34. Infertility and Assisted Reproductive Technologies
35. Menopause and Perimenopause
36. Menstrual Cycle-Influenced Disorders
PART 5 Gynecologic Oncology
37. Principles of Cancer Therapy
38. Cervical Dysplasia and Cancer
39. Ovarian, Fallopian Tube, and Peritoneal Cancer
40. Vulvar and Vaginal Cancer
41. Uterine Corpus Cancer
42. Gestational Trophoblastic Diseases
